IRAC-scaffolded case analysis memo with research gaps flagged — the scaffold, not the analysis. Rule blocks are RESEARCH NEEDED, Application is STUDENT ANALYSIS prompts, Conclusion is blank. Use when a student needs to scaffold a case analysis memo, write up their analysis, or build an IRAC memo for a case.

Highly actionable and clearly sequenced with strong verification checkpoints, but held back by redundancy across the 'NOT' sections and a monolithic structure with no reference-file split.

Suggestions

Collapse 'What this memo is NOT' and 'What this skill does NOT do' into the Purpose section — they repeat 'scaffold, not analysis; student does the thinking' verbatim.

Mention the 'the analysis is yours' framing once (in the output banner) rather than restating it in the Purpose, Step 5, and the NOT section.

Move the large output template block (lines ~116–198) into a bundled reference file (e.g. references/memo-template.md) referenced from the Workflow section to reduce inline bulk.
